aboutsummaryrefslogtreecommitdiffstats
path: root/main/tiff/APKB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'main/tiff/APKBUILD')
-rw-r--r--main/tiff/APKBUILD11
1 files changed, 9 insertions, 2 deletions
diff --git a/main/tiff/APKBUILD b/main/tiff/APKBUILD
index d90bacd682..3d0558d6a4 100644
--- a/main/tiff/APKBUILD
+++ b/main/tiff/APKBUILD
@@ -11,7 +11,7 @@ license="libtiff"
depends=
depends_dev="zlib-dev libjpeg-turbo-dev"
makedepends="libtool autoconf automake $depends_dev"
-subpackages="$pkgname-doc $pkgname-dev $pkgname-tools"
+subpackages="$pkgname-doc $pkgname-dev $pkgname-tools libtiffxx:_libtiffxx"
builddir="$srcdir/$pkgname-$pkgver"
source="http://download.osgeo.org/libtiff/$pkgname-$pkgver.tar.gz
CVE-2017-9935.patch
@@ -69,7 +69,8 @@ build() {
--prefix=/usr \
--sysconfdir=/etc \
--mandir=/usr/share/man \
- --infodir=/usr/share/info
+ --infodir=/usr/share/info \
+ --enable-cxx
make
}
@@ -83,6 +84,12 @@ package() {
make DESTDIR="$pkgdir" install
}
+_libtiffxx() {
+ pkgdesc="C++ binding to libtiff"
+ mkdir -p "$subpkgdir"/usr/lib/
+ mv "$pkgdir"/usr/lib/libtiffxx.so.* "$subpkgdir"/usr/lib/
+}
+
tools() {
pkgdesc="Command-line utility programs for manipulating TIFF files"
mkdir -p "$subpkgdir"/usr/